Thank you >> >>Eric ... code snipped ... >> > Try this ( just run python sinewave.py and it should generate 2 seconds > of 2khz at 75% amplitude that you can listen to with media player. > Also will plot the first 34 samples on console screen, self-scaling > when it exceeds the display region (right away here). See after this. > My media player didn't like 4-byte samples, so that was changed, among > other things ;-) > ... code and curve snipped > Regards, > Bengt Richter The original poster might also be interested in the following version (based upon Bengt's code) that uses the Numeric module for speed and code economy. #################################################### from Numeric import floor, arange, sin, pi import wave #init output and related vars samplesPerSecond = 44100 Outfile = wave.open("outfile.wav", "w") Outfile.setnchannels(1) Outfile.setsampwidth(2) # 2 bytes for 32767 amplitude Outfile.setframerate(samplesPerSecond) Outfile.setcomptype("NONE", "Uncompressed") def gen_wav(seconds, frequency, amplitudePercentOfMax): # calculate frequency as radians/sample radiansPerSample = (2.0 * pi * frequency) / samplesPerSecond numberOfSamples = int(seconds*samplesPerSecond) maxAmplitude = (amplitudePercentOfMax / 100.0) * 32767 samples = sin(arange(numberOfSamples) * radiansPerSample) * maxAmplitude # round and convert to array of 16-bit shorts return floor(samples + 0.5).astype('s') if __name__ == '__main__': sampleArray = gen_wav(2, 2000, 75) Outfile.writeframes(sampleArray.tostring()) # little-endian cpu only Outfile.close() --Andy
